If I am doing a treatment of hyposalinity, is it neccessary to adjust ph to 8.0 or is the salt parameter of 1.009 the only concern?
 
Depends on what fish you are treating. Wrasses typically require a little more attention when it comes to pH in hyposalinity. But clownfish and even tangs do fine without special care to pH.
 
The pH will likely slip below 8 easily. due to the decreased buffer capacity.
A pH of 7.8 would still acceptable but I added some 2-part solution to keep it above 8.
